Output 76b94cc46ae15a7aeb3667474d887a283a31738ac615b725981b239d6207bbca:1

value
31350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7815df3fd1642a2e8332eb62ffefcd273ae2afa8 OP_EQUAL
address
3CdyDG7G95zZBqWsJKovD8hp6cuuDtZuZG
transaction
76b94cc46ae15a7aeb3667474d887a283a31738ac615b725981b239d6207bbca
confirmations
208858
spent
true